What is this?

This private, exclusive evening unfolds entirely within the Palácio de Mateus — an iconic 18th century Baroque estate completed in 1743 and designated a National Monument in 1910. After public hours, you’ll enter through the main gate, when the palace and reflective pond lie silent. A senior guide from the Casa de Mateus Foundation will lead you through the most emblematic rooms including intricately carved chestnut wood salons, private chapel, 16th century winery, and formal gardens shaped over centuries. Then, in a reserved dining salon, a dedicated chef prepares a five course tasting menu rooted in the Douro’s heritage. Each dish highlights regional DOP ingredients, paired with Lavradores de Feitoria wines — the palace’s own brand, named after the 2000 cooperative project it helped launch. With no other guests, this is a private celebration among national treasures. Ideal for marking a milestone — an anniversary, proposal, or significant birthday.

What makes this unique?

This is a curated evening of rarity and intimacy. Your visit begins after the palace is closed to the public, and the façade is quietly illuminated. It’s a rare privilege of access. A Foundation specialist guide opens rooms – some of which are normally off limits, sharing insights into this Baroque masterpiece by Nicolau Nasoni, the family’s lineage, and the palace’s cultural significance. At night, the estate takes on a stillness once reserved for the family themselves — quiet, romantic, and uninterrupted. Dinner follows in a historic salon, with table set just for you. Between courses, you may wander and take photos, revisit favorite paintings, or step into the garden under the stars. The private chef and sommelier attend solely to your table, pairing each course with wines that trace Douro’s diversity. The format— after-hours palace access, private salon dining, full estate immersion — creates an evening of exclusive elegance.
